  • Patent number: 11501008
    Abstract: Embodiments described herein ensure differential privacy when transmitting data to a server that estimates a frequency of such data amongst a set of client devices. The differential privacy mechanism may provide a predictable degree of variance for frequency estimations of data. The system may use a multibit histogram model or Hadamard multibit model for the differential privacy mechanism, both of which provide a predictable degree of accuracy of frequency estimations while still providing mathematically provable levels of privacy.

  • Patent number: 11503151
    Abstract: Disclosed are a communication device having a base station function of a Digital Enhanced Cordless Telecommunications (DECT) cellular system, and a communication system. The communication device includes an IP phone and a DECT adapter. The IP phone is connected to the DECT adapter, to form a base station; and the DECT adapter is configured to wirelessly communicate with at least one cordless handset via DECT, so as to register information of the at least one cordless handset with the IP phone. The present application enables the IP phone to be externally connected to the DECT adapter to support a DECT mode, so that the IP phone possesses a base station function of a DECT cellular system. It is not required to deploy multiple different systems. Such an IP phone and other base stations can form a Multi-Cell DECT system, expanding the coverage of a DECT signal.

  • Patent number: 11501792
    Abstract: A distributed voice controlled system has a primary assistant and at least one secondary assistant. The primary assistant has a housing to hold one or more microphones, one or more speakers, and various computing components. The secondary assistant is similar in structure, but is void of speakers. The voice controlled assistants perform transactions and other functions primarily based on verbal interactions with a user. The assistants within the system are coordinated and synchronized to perform acoustic echo cancellation, selection of a best audio input from among the assistants, and distributed processing.

  • Patent number: 11439920
    Abstract: The present invention provides a mobile terminal with a call function or a texting function. The present invention controls the use of a mobile terminal by a manual operation because of an incoming call during movement. Location information indicating movement of a mobile terminal with a call or a message data exchange function is received by a GPS receiver, the distance and the movement speed are determined by using the measurement information of the two locations at every predetermined time, and whether or not the mobile terminal is moving in accordance with the movement speed is determined by a movement determination unit. When it is determined by the movement determination unit that the mobile terminal is moving, the display of incoming call information indicating an incoming call is set to non-displayed on the display unit, and at the same time, a notification sound from a speaker, etc. is invalid.

  • Patent number: 11405175
    Abstract: A hardened VoIP system is presented that includes secure push-to-talk voice functionality. Through the addition of encryption, authentication, user filtering, and integration with new and existing LMR systems, a secure voice platform ensures malicious software, unauthorized access and brute force security attacks will not compromise the voice communications of the system. The VoIP system is engineered to ensure graceful system degradation in the event of maintenance activities, natural disasters and failure modes. The hardened VoIP system offers the functions a LMR trunking system while utilizing broadband connections. Private calls, group calls, Emergency Alarms with covert monitoring capability, scanning and priority scanning may be incorporated into the system. The system includes a VoIP controller that serves as a trunking controller, manages available VoIP based conference bridges, and assigns them as needed to the parties involved in each voice call.
